From the many books I've read about the USSR and the state security apparatuses (apparati?), totalitarians hold the opposite view.
Both Dolgun and Solzhenitsyn wrote about instances of individuals being hunted down by the NKVD and MGB simply for writing to Stalin about apparatchiks who were abusing their position. What the person wrote was true; however, the individuals were charged with anti-Soviet acts, notably Article 58-10 of the Soviet Penal Code. The Chekists did this by comparing the complainant's handwriting to the mandatory writing exemplars required of every adult. Yes, they kept writing exemplars from everyone.
After all the State cannot do wrong, and by extension, the upper echelons of the State can do no wrong.
